Which languages are you currently using?

Survey period: 15 Jul 2019 to 22 Jul 2019

Our semi-regular check-up of the mix of languages we're all using.

OptionVotes% 
Assembly875.85
C24516.48
C++41027.57
C#94563.55
Go322.15
Groovy130.87
Java21114.19
JavaScript55337.19
Kotlin231.55
PHP15410.36
Python27318.36
R291.95
Ruby161.08
Scala40.27
Swift211.41
SQL65544.05
TypeScript17011.43
Visual Basic / VB.NET31521.18
Other20213.58
I don't code171.14
Respondents were allowed to choose more than one answer; totals may not add up to 100%
